Grasping the Importance of an Official Agent
A designated agent serves as a crucial link between a company and the law. This designated individual or entity is responsible for collecting critical paperwork on behalf of a business, including judicial notifications, tax documents, and compliance notices. By serving as the primary liaison, registered agents confirm that business owners are informed of any requirements that may affect business operations.
In the state of Washington, having an official agent is not just a recommended procedure; it is a legal requirement for limited liability companies and incorporations. The registered agent must have a real address in the state and be available during business hours to receive service of process. This function protects companies by guaranteeing they follow local laws and maintain their good standing. Without a trustworthy agent, the company risks neglecting important messages that could lead to legal challenges or regulatory difficulties.

Perks of Having a Trustworthy Registered Agent in Washington
Having a dependable registered agent in the State of Washington gives critical support for companies, ensuring compliance with local regulations. A registered agent acts as the official point of contact for your enterprise, accepting legal documents, government correspondence, and service of process. This allows business owners to concentrate on their activities, knowing that vital communications are handled professionally and swiftly.
Additionally major advantage is the privacy and security a registered agent offers. By using a registered agent's address, business owners can keep their personal address confidential, reducing the risk of undesired solicitations and maintaining a level of anonymity. This can be particularly helpful for small business owners who may operate from home or within a shared space, giving them with a more professional appearance.
Moreover, a trustworthy registered agent helps businesses deal with the complexities of legal mandates in the State of Washington. They can assist with annual report filings and make sure that all required paperwork is filed on time. This preemptive approach to compliance not just avoid penalties but also keeps the business in good standing with the state, which is crucial for sustained success.

Frequent Criteria and Adherence for Appointed Agents in Washington
In Washington, appointed agents must meet particular requirements set by the government. To serve as a designated agent, a individual or business entity must have a real location in WA, known as a official office. This location is where legal notices and official correspondence are delivered during standard business times. A post office box is not permissible as a designated office. Additionally, the appointed agent must be present to receive legal notifications, ensuring that they can carry out their duties adequately.
Registered agents in Washington must also be available during standard business times. This implies that the appointed agent should not only be present but also able to respond to inquiries or legal papers as they arrive. Organizations often choose to hire professional appointed agents to ensure compliance with this criterion, as it can be difficult for entrepreneurs to maintain ongoing accessibility. This solution allows entrepreneurs to focus on operating their companies while being confident that all legal communications are handled correctly.
Conformity with official regulations entails the obligation to notify the Washington Secretary of State when there are adjustments to the designated agent or location. This procedure includes completing the relevant papers and paying any associated fees. It is essential for businesses to remain adherent to avoid fines or loss of status. Frequently reviewing registered agent information and ensuring it is revised can help businesses maintain good standing and ensure they receive vital communications on time.

Changing The Registered Agent in WA
Changing the registered agent in WA is a simple process that ensures the business remains in compliance with state regulations. To initiate the change, you will need to submit the appropriate form provided by the Washington Secretary of State. Once you have completed the form, you will need to deliver it along with any necessary fees to the WA Secretary of State's office. Usually, the processing time is fast, enabling you to revise your records without significant delays. Ensure that the new registered agent is notified and consents to accept the responsibilities before you conclude the change. This communication is essential as the registered agent must be willing to receive legal documents and other important communications for the business.
After your change is finalized, it is essential to refresh your business records to reflect the new registered agent information. This involves notifying any relevant parties, such as your bank and business partners, of the change.
